如何使用QSqlDatabase连接数据库

 时间:2026-02-15 15:50:42

1、通过QtCreator打开Qt工程,pro文件中添加sql的支持

如何使用QSqlDatabase连接数据库

2、实现文件中包含QSqlDatabase、QSqlQuery等相关头文件

如何使用QSqlDatabase连接数据库

3、调用QSqlDatabase::addDatabase来创建数据库的实例,再调用数据库实例的函数setDatabaseName来设置数据库名称

如何使用QSqlDatabase连接数据库

4、接着封装Open和Close函数,用来打开和关闭数据库连接

如何使用QSqlDatabase连接数据库

5、实现sql的执行语句,调用QSqlQuery获取执行对象,再通过返回的QSqlQuery对象调用prepare和exec来执行sql语句

如何使用QSqlDatabase连接数据库

6、接下来编写测试代码查看数据库连接是否正常,如下图所示,调用上面实现的相关函数,先创建数据表,然后插入数据,最后执行查询数据表语句

如何使用QSqlDatabase连接数据库

7、最后从运行的打印信息看,测试代码正确从数据表中查询到预期信息

如何使用QSqlDatabase连接数据库

1、创建数据库连接

2、设置数据库名称

3、打开数据库

4、执行sql语句

5、关闭数据库

  • 手机流量怎么充值 联通怎么充值流量
  • 东方财富APP如何关闭DDX参数
  • 英雄无间道攻略
  • 腾讯会议怎么开启智能模式
  • 石林附近还有什么好玩的景区
  • 热门搜索
    淘宝怎么开网店 营业利润怎么算 鼻塞怎么通 微信直播间怎么开通 柯珞克怎么样 跳舞毯怎么连接电视 经常出汗是怎么回事 肾结石怎么排出 立升净水器怎么样 脸上出现白块怎么办